Q: The nightly inventory reconciliation job at Stockmere flagged a mismatch. What now?

A: Don't adjust counts manually. Check the job log for the affected SKUs, confirm whether a receiving batch was mid-flight, and rerun with the dry-run flag first. Escalate anything over 50 units. Full procedure is on the internal runbook page.

wiki page, hahif-hahif: https://argocd.kelvisys.corp/browse/board/settings/pages/1442e0b1065d83f1

## Deployment

The Quillbrook public REST API paginates all list endpoints with cursor tokens. Page size limits and cursor TTLs are set at deploy time and must match across every region, otherwise clients get invalid-cursor errors mid-pagination. Before promoting a release, confirm the staging and production values agree. The deployment pipeline reads the settings below at startup, and the current values are these.

config for kagup-hahig:
druwyn:
  pin: 2801
  metrics_host: metrics.druwyn.zemvarlabs.internal
  tenant: sorius
  seal: seal_798a43d7

## Service Accounts: Nightfill Scheduler

Nightfill is the cron-ish service that kicks off nightly data backfills for the Quarrystone warehouse. It runs under the svc-nightfill account, so don't panic if you see it in the audit logs at 2am — that's normal. If a backfill stalls, you can poke the scheduler API directly. Use the key below:

gateway credential: kto23_dolYgAScEh2TaPOlStqOl98

### Partner SFTP Drop — Ingest Flow

Files uploaded to the Lanternhook partner SFTP drop are scanned, renamed with a batch suffix, and handed to the Corvette ingest pipeline within ten minutes. Please verify checksums before upload, since partial files are quarantined for 72 hours and require a manual release. When polling ingest status, call the internal Corvette status endpoint rather than listing the drop directory, as listings lag behind. Authenticate those status calls with the key below.

service key, kaduf-bawig: kto15_Ze79S0dligTw0yO